The UK 100 is called to open -8 points at at 10,645. The UK 100 looks set to open marginally lower this morning following fresh military escalation in the Middle East, as investors also assess the latest Federal Reserve minutes.
In domestic news Al Carns has ruled himself out of the Labour leadership race, paving the way for Andy Burnham to become UK prime minister. Though nominations for the leadership contest open on Thursday and prospective candidates technically have time to get the necessary 81 MP backers, the former armed forces minister is thought to be the last viable challenger who was considering whether to put himself forward. In the absence of any other candidates, former Greater Manchester mayor Burnham will be formally declared Labour leader at a special conference on July 17. He is expected to become prime minister on July 20.
The Dow Jones fell sharply on Wednesday after U.S. President Donald Trump told the NATO summit in Turkey that the ceasefire with Iran is “over” amid renewed hostilities in the Middle East that sent oil prices surging.
The 30-stock index dropped 576.76 points, or 1.09%, to end at 52,348.39. The S&P was down 0.28%, closing at 7,482.71. The Nasdaq bucked the trend and rose 0.2% to settle at 25,870.65.
International Brent crude futures settled up 5.43% at $78.19 per barrel. West Texas Intermediate futures popped 4.37% to close at $73.52.
In Asia on Thursday, the Nikkei 225 index in Tokyo was up 1.3%. In China, the Shanghai Composite was 0.1%, while the Hang Seng index in Hong Kong was down 1.0%. The S&P/ASX 200 in Sydney was down 0.4%.
